[0053] Example 3 TNF-αELISA detection

[0054] Lycium barbarum polysaccharide (LRP) and its five main components (LRP1-LRP5) were respectively prepared into 10 mg / mL storage solution with PBS, and diluted with medium to a working concentration of 1 mg / mL for drug treatment in mice. Phage cells RAW264.7 were purchased from the Cell Bank of Shanghai Institute of Biological Sciences, Chinese Academy of Sciences, stored in liquid nitrogen, and cultured in DMEM medium containing 10% fetal bovine serum (Gibco). They were cultured in an incubator at 37°C with saturated humidity, 5% CO2 and 95% air, digested with 0.25% trypsin and passaged. RAW264.7 cells at 1×10 6 The density of cells / well was inoculated in a 24-well plate. After 24 hours of adherence, the culture medium was replaced with each group of drugs diluted with the culture medium. The drug concentration was 1mg / mL, and each group had two duplicate holes. Abstract

The invention relates to an application of lycium ruthenicum polysaccharides in preparation of immunoregulation medicines or health-care products. The lycium ruthenicum polysaccharides refer to a group of glycoprotein complex which have the molecular weight of 80-22kDa and are obtained by performing hot water extraction, ethanol precipitation, deproteinization and discoloring on lycium ruthenicum fruits. The animal experiments prove that the lycium ruthenicum polysaccharides have the effects of obviously improving the spleen and thymus indexes of immunosuppressed mice and improving the lymphocytes level of the immunosuppressed mice; the delayed type hypersensitivity of the immunosuppressed mice is enhanced; the antibody secreting level of the immunosuppressed mice is improved. The cell experiments prove that the spleen cell proliferation rate of the mice can be obviously improved through the lycium ruthenicum polysaccharides, macrophage cell lines RAW264.7 of the mice are promoted to secrete TNF (tumor necrosis factor)-alpha, NO and other immune factors, and the lycium ruthenicum polysaccharides are proved to have high immunological competences.

technical field [0001] The invention relates to the fields of food health care and medicine, in particular to the application of polysaccharides from black fruit Lycium barbarum in the preparation of immunomodulatory drugs or health care products Background technique [0002] In recent years, low immune function, including primary and secondary immune function deficiency, deficiency or damage, has been widely concerned by researchers at home and abroad, because they themselves and the various complications induced, especially infection, often Make the patient's condition worse, difficult to treat, and can cause serious consequences, even life-threatening. Therefore, finding safe drugs to improve the body's immune function will save more patients, and has a good application prospect in the health care industry.
